Alabama Statutes

§ 36-28-1 — Definitions

Alabama·Title 36 Public Officers and Employees·Ch. 28 Social Security for State, Municipal, Etc., Employees

When used in this chapter, the following terms shall have the following meanings, respectively, unless the context clearly indicates otherwise:

(1)WAGES. All remuneration for employment, as defined in subdivision (2) of this section, including the cash value of all remuneration paid in any medium other than cash; except, that such term shall not include that part of such remuneration which, even if it were for “employment” within the meaning of the federal Insurance Contributions Act, would not constitute “wages” within the meaning of that act.
